Are you using Kotlin in the backend? If so, that's a solid choice! Kotlin is a modern, statically typed language well-loved for its safety features, which drastically reduce common programming errors. Designed to be fully interoperable with Java, Kotlin allows you to keep the good parts of your existing Java expertise and resources.

Talking About the Main Advantages of Kotlin for Backend

So, what makes Kotlin really shine in backend development? It's all down to its expressive syntax, powerful features, and strong focus on null safety. With less boilerplate code, backend developers can write more readable and reliable server-side applications faster.

How does Kotlin fare in backend, you wonder?

First, let's look at performance. Kotlin shines. Its performance is similar to Java. Why? Kotlin runs on the Java Virtual Machine (JVM). It leverages JVM's performance optimizations.

Tips to Master SDLC Models: Key Skills for Tech Executives

- Software Development Life Cycle (SDLC) models guide software creation with structured stages of planning, analyzing, designing, coding, testing, and maintenance. - Different SDLC models include the Waterfall model, Agile model, Iterative, Spiral, and V-model, each with benefits and drawbacks. - Choice of SDLC model should consider client needs, project scope, team capabilities, costs, and risk assessment. - Waterfall model suits projects with clear, unmoving plans while Agile model caters to projects requiring flexibility and frequent changes. - SDLC models assist in IT project management by streamlining processes, aiding in time and cost estimation, and resource planning. - They also influence software architecture, providing a blueprint for software components' design, structure, and interaction. - Emerging technologies like AI, AR, VR, and IoT are guiding the evolution of SDLC models towards greater adaptability and responsiveness to customer needs. - SDLC models facilitate software upgrades and enhancements by enabling systematic tracking, documentation, debugging, and maintenance.

Scrum Master vs Project Manager: Who Does What?

- Scrum Masters act as coaches, facilitating the team's use of Scrum and helping them improve their skills, while Project Managers have a more directive role, steering projects to completion. - Scrum Masters employ Scrum methodologies, focusing on incremental progress, whereas Project Managers use traditional project management techniques, overseeing the entire project from start to end. - Scrum Masters guide the team's flow without imposing deadlines; Project Managers operate on a strict project timeline. - The Scrum Master's role focuses on serving the team and reinforcing Scrum principles, while the Project Manager's role encompasses planning, executing, and closing projects. - Certifications for Scrum Masters include Certified ScrumMaster (CSM), whereas Project Management Professional (PMP) is popular among Project Managers.
